Ingredients
for
12
-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 Tbsp Baking powder
- 1 pinch mustard powder
- 1 tsp salt
- freshly ground Black pepper
- 2 tsps snipped Chives
- 1 large egg
- ½ cup soft cream cheese (with herbs)
- ⅞ cup milk
- 2 Tomatoes (diced)
- 2 scallions (thinly sliced)
- ⅓ cup cooked ham (diced)
- ¾ cup Cheddar cheese (grated)

The secret to light airy muffins is to avoid over-mixing when adding the wet ingredients to the dry ones – stir until only just combined and still slightly lumpy.
Preparation steps
1.
Heat the oven to 180°C (160° fan) 350°F gas 4. Grease a 12 hole muffin tin.
2.
Sift the flour, baking powder and mustard powder into a mixing bowl, and add the salt, freshly ground black pepper and chives.
3.
Whisk together the egg, soft cheese and milk until smooth. Stir in the tomatoes, spring onions and ham.
4.
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ients, and mix gently until just incorporated. The mixture will be slightly lumpy.
5.
Spoon into the greased paper cases and sprinkle the top of each muffin with grated cheese. Bake for about 20 minutes, until the muffins are golden and firm to the touch. Serve warm.
